DetailsDescription:
:: Starting full system upgrade... resolving dependencies... warning: cannot resolve "libtar", a dependency of "vlc" warning: cannot resolve "libtiger", a dependency of "vlc" I've only core and extra in my pacman.conf activated, libtar and libtiger are in community repro As far as I know should packages from core or extra never depend on packages from community Please move libtar and libtiger in extra repo Additional info: vlc 2.0.0-6 Steps to reproduce: disable community repro and run pacms -S vlc |
